Life & Work with Juan Castaneda of Millcreek

Today we’d like to introduce you to Juan Castaneda.

Hi Juan, thanks for sharing your story with us. To start, maybe you can tell our readers some of your backstory.
I studied audiovisual production in my birth country, Colombia, and had the experience of working for TV series doing still photography. Then I went to study documentary photography in Argentina, where I have been developing different audiovisual projects such as documentaries, music videos, and lately, portrait photography here in Utah.

Alright, so let’s dig a little deeper into the story – has it been an easy path overall and if not, what were the challenges you’ve had to overcome?
It has not been an easy path since starting over in each country where I have lived makes it a bit difficult to generate new contacts so that they know your work and can spread it and get to know the specific market of each place.

As you know, we’re big fans of you and your work. For our readers who might not be as familiar what can you tell them about what you do?
I’ve been working on audiovisual projects in general, although recently I’ve specialized in music videos and portrait photography. I have another project inspired by the nature of Utah, featuring landscape photography. I think I’ve become known for portraits and audiovisual projects with music.I’m proud that I’ve been able to pursue my artistic work while simultaneously being a single father, where things often get complicated without family or support, but you always get ahead. With a positive attitude and love, everything is possible.I think I stand out for having a perspective that comes from observing other realities as a Latino, and the sensitivity to perceive something new and special in the ordinary or common and to value everything even more.

We all have a different way of looking at and defining success. How do you define success?
For me, success is being able to have health and energy to be able to do what makes you happy in life.
